Ah, no luck. That reset the Large Center screen. My issue is the the center of the dash, between the tach and speedometer. I lost my Trip 1, 2, MPG, and the screen to pick which views show.
Yea, I getcha. But on the 2025 models, the IPC is managed by the APIM, so it won't hurt to try. That you know of, did the vehicle receive an OTA update recently?

If you have FORScan, I would try going into the IPC, APIM and GWM procedures under the wrench icon and reboot all three modules. If you don't, then I would try disconnecting the negative cable from the 12v battery and reconnecting it. This is will force a hard reset of the module network.
